Level 2—Quoted prices for similar instruments in active markets; quoted prices for identical or similar instruments in markets that are not active; and model-derived valuations in which all significant inputs are observable in active markets; and
|
|
•
|
Level 3—Valuations derived from valuation techniques in which one or more significant inputs are unobservable.

The historical volatilities are used over the most recent three-year period for the components of the peer group.
|
|
•
|
The risk-free interest rate is based on the U.S. Treasury rate assumption commensurate with the three-year performance period
|
|
•
|
Since the plan stipulates that the awards are based upon the TSR of the Company and the components of the peer group, it is assumed that the dividends get reinvested in the issuing entity on a continuous basis.
|
|
•
|
The correlation coefficients are used to model the way in which each entity tends to move in relation to each other are based upon the price data used to calculate the historical volatilities.
